A collaboration with Seattle Public Schools’ Career Connected Learning Office, Open Science Quest is designed for students considering futures in science, health, and technology. The program introduces participants to research careers, laboratory environments, and the realities of working in science today.
Students earn career and technical education credit toward high school graduation, receive a $500 stipend, and leave with hands‑on experience that supports college, training, and career pathways.
Students learn by doing — from analyzing real data and running experiments to discussing ethics in modern science and presenting their work to peers and scientists.
